This paper presents an autonomous intelligent agent with a human thinking reasoning model, based on past experiences. The agent is developed to assist medical staff in geriatric residences. The health care process is a vital function, requiring nature-inspired solutions imitating the residence staff behaviours. An autonomous deliberative Case-Based Planner agent, AGALZ (Autonomous aGent for monitoring ALZheimer patients), is developed and integrated into an environment-aware multi-agent system, named ALZ-MAS (ALZheimer Multi-Agent System), to optimize health care in geriatric residences. ALZ-MAS is capable of obtaining information about the environment through RFID technology.
